Choreographer - Alice Hollywood
Alice has been a professional in the arts for 2 decades now. She is a professional dancer and has had an incredible career traveling the world doing what she loves. She has featured on shows such as the X Factor, This Morning and The Paul O Grady Show. Alice was one of the UK top 10 dancers in the the hit show "So You Think You Can Dance" that aired on the BBC1.
Alice is currently building her career as a successful Soloartist, chasing her music dreams, releasing her original female empowerment tunes for the world to dance to. Whist simultaneously she has decided to launch this energising and uplifting dance class called DANCE TO LIVE.
Alice has recently gone back to professional dance and she has witnessed immediate results in both her body and mind. Dance is a game changer to Alice's quality of life and she believes so many people would benefit from dancing regularly.
